Rajinikanth's upcoming Tamil action entertainer Dharman, directed by Ashwath Marimuthu and produced by Raaj Kamal Films International, has completed its second schedule of filming, the production house announced on Friday, 4 September. The shoot, which kicked off on 13 August, concluded with footage that offers the first glimpse of Rajinikanth in his role as a senior medical professional.
Second Schedule: What Was Shot
Raaj Kamal Films International confirmed the wrap on its social media channels, sharing a video clip with the caption: 'Dharman 2nd Schedule Wrapped. Swag Mode: ON.' One of the scenes in the clip showed Rajinikanth portraying a senior medical faculty member lecturing a group of junior doctors — a sequence that underlines the film's hospital-set premise.
The second schedule had been announced on 13 August, when the makers described the project as 'legendary' and teased Rajinikanth's character with the phrase 'The deadly doctor.'
Rajinikanth's Look and the Making Process
Excitement around Dharman has been building since June, when the production house released a behind-the-scenes making video detailing how the team arrived at Rajinikanth's look for the film. Director Ashwath Marimuthu shared a fresh character poster on X (formerly Twitter), crediting hair stylist Kabilan Chelliah and writing: 'We heard you!! Ithan hair styleu!! Ithan looku! Sexy work @kabilanchelliah.'
An earlier glimpse video released by the production house, titled 'THE OG SWAG — The Making of the First Look,' showed the accessories curated for Rajinikanth to choose from and captured director Marimuthu demonstrating the exact pose he envisioned. The clip also featured actor, producer, and parliamentarian Kamal Haasan alongside Rajinikanth, with the two Tamil cinema legends seen exchanging pleasantries on set.
Story and Character Details
In Dharman, Rajinikanth plays a doctor who confronts criminals — a premise that blends his signature vigilante persona with a medical backdrop. The title poster, released earlier, depicted Rajinikanth in an operation theatre holding a scalpel, with one leg placed over a slain antagonist — a visual that immediately went viral among fans.
While announcing the film's title, Kamal Haasan wrote: 'Dharmame vellum! (Only Dharma will win)' — framing the film's moral core from the outset.
Crew and Technical Team
The film is being produced by Kamal Haasan and R. Mahendran, and co-produced by S. Disney. Music is composed by Anirudh Ravichander, cinematography is handled by Niketh Bommi, and editing is by Pradeep E. Raghav. Action sequences are choreographed by Anbariv, the National Award-winning stunt duo.
